Cast: the children performers all do a great job and most of the adult do good as well, but Gene Wilder as Willy Wonka he makes this character is very own and I will even go one more step and say whomever tries to bring this film back for another remake or reboot [I am not saying they will, I'm just saying if they do,] they will have big shoes to fill, because Wilder really does understand the balance in the mind-set of this character, meaning sometimes he is calm and intelligent with dialogue exchanges to match, while other times he can be intense and leaning toward madness. But the most interesting thing about this performance and this version of this character is this; you cannot have one side of his character's personality without the other, because both sides of his personality keep him balanced in the world of his creation and design, not forgetting sometimes his mind-set is in the middle using elements from each side, to have conversations or questions or any comment that he doesn't want to reply to [or if he does it is usually with a short comment or something that doesn't make crystal clear sense,] and on top of that how quickly and naturally he rotates from one mind-set to another with ease is just great fun to watch.
